In this episode, I chat with acclaimed author CEO Coach Kim Scott about her leadership journey and new book "Radical Respect."
We discuss:
- Her early career path from Moscow to Google (1:23)
- Battling imposter syndrome and writer's block (4:56)
- The importance of including diverse perspectives (9:45)
- What radical respect looks like in the workplace (14:34)
- Actionable ways to be an upstander against bias (21:12)
- Advice for women struggling with sticky floors (26:54)
Kim's vulnerability and wisdom around embracing feedback, mitigating bias, and helping others thrive makes this a must-listen for anyone in a leadership role!
Some of Kim's top insights:
"When you are succeeding, never think you're as good as you feel. And when you are failing, never think you are as bad as you feel." (6:23)
"The necessary condition for radical candor is respect." (17:45)
"I want to think of myself as a victim. That felt like it was going to hurt my sense of agency, but what really hurt my sense of agency was the denial." (10:56)
